Datasheets are instrumental in a variety of network-related activities. Here are a few examples:
- Capacity Planning: The datasheet reveals the maximum number of ports, bandwidth capacity, and switching throughput, enabling precise capacity planning.
- Module Selection: It specifies the types of line cards supported, allowing you to choose the optimal mix of interfaces (e.g., 10 Gigabit Ethernet, 40 Gigabit Ethernet, 100 Gigabit Ethernet) for your needs.
- Troubleshooting: The datasheet can assist in troubleshooting by providing information on expected performance levels and hardware specifications.
Beyond the hardware specifications, the datasheet also provides insights into the software features supported by the Nexus 7004. This includes details on:
- Operating System: The specific version of Cisco NX-OS supported.
- Protocols: Supported routing protocols (e.g., BGP, OSPF, EIGRP), switching protocols (e.g., VLAN, STP), and other relevant networking protocols.
- Security Features: Information on access control lists (ACLs), role-based access control (RBAC), and other security mechanisms.
A quick overview of chassis specifications:
| Feature | Value |
|---|---|
| Number of Slots | 4 |
| Power Supplies | Redundant |
| Cooling | Front-to-back |
